Description

  • Victor Pasmore, R.A.
  • Brown image (T. & H. 30)
  • Lithograph, etching, screenprint on paper
  • sheet: 95 by 95.5cm.; 37 3/8 by 37 5/8 in.
Etching with lithograph and screenprint in colours, 1972, signed in pencil, dated, numbered 9/90, on wove paper (unframed)

Condition

The full sheet, in good condition apart from partial remains of tape along part of the extreme left, right and upper sheet edges, a surface scratch inthe lower image area (apparently retouched with brown pigment), a few short creases in the printed area, 5cm crease at the upper sheet area, a crease across the tip of the upper right corner, a soft handling crease at right sheet edge, unframed.
